10+ Acres of Remote Desert Land in Yuma County - 0432

Check out this fantastic, remote property located about 30 minutes from the quaint town of Dateland, AZ. With abundant sunshine and nutrient rich soil from the nearby Gila River, this area is primed for agricultural development. You could create a small farm or your own homesteading escape. Take advantage of green resources, including solar or wind power, rainwater harvesting, zero-waste living, and more.

You'll find the parcel in south western Arizona, less than an hour and a half from the City of Yuma. More than 175 types of crops and seeds can be grown in Yuma County, the largest of these crops being lettuce. Other notable crops include lemons, melons, cotton, alfalfa, grains, cotton, dates, and wheat.
